开源高效在线电子表格解决方案:Luckysheet

Luckysheet体验幸运,掌握高效数据表格编辑!- 精选真开源,释放新价值。

1.png

概览

Luckysheet 是一个功能强大、配置简单且完全开源的在线电子表格工具,它类似于我们熟知的 Excel,但更加灵活和易于集成。它是一款纯前端实现的,功能强大、配置简单、支持大部分 Excel 功能,如冻结行列、合并单元格、筛选、排序。并内置了透视表、图表、计算函数等数据分析常用功能。作为在线应用,Luckysheet 支持丰富的数据处理功能,包括但不限于数据格式化、单元格操作、行列管理、撤销与重做、公式与函数处理、数据过滤与排序等。它还提供了高级功能,如数据透视表、图表插件、评论、协作编辑等,满足从个人到企业级用户的多样化需求。Luckysheet 的开发和维护遵循 MIT 许可证,鼓励社区贡献和商业使用。


主要功能

你可以进入官方网站查阅文档:https://dream-num.github.io/LuckysheetDocs/zh/guide

2.gif

  • 格式化

Luckysheet 提供了一系列格式化工具,使用户能够根据需求调整单元格的外观和内容展示。样式设置允许用户定义字体、大小、颜色和边框等属性,以增强数据的可读性和美观性。条件格式化则可以根据单元格内容的变化自动应用格式规则,使得关键数据一目了然。文本对齐与旋转功能让用户可以精确控制文本在单元格中的位置和方向,适应不同语言和布局的需求。文本截断与溢出处理功能确保长文本的显示不会破坏表格的整体布局。自动换行功能则让长文本在单元格内自动换行,保持表格的整洁。此外,Luckysheet 支持多种数据类型的单元格格式化,包括数字、日期、货币等,以适应不同种类的数据输入和展示。

  • 单元格操作

在单元格操作方面,Luckysheet 提供了直观而强大的功能集。拖放功能让用户可以轻松地移动或调整单元格内容的位置。填充手柄允许用户通过拖动来复制或序列化数据,极大地提高了数据输入的效率。多选功能使用户可以选择多个单元格并一次性应用格式或进行编辑。查找替换工具快速定位并替换表格中的文本,节省了手动搜索和更改的时间。定位功能帮助用户快速跳转到特定的单元格或范围,提高了导航的效率。合并单元格允许用户将多个单元格合并为一个更大的单元格,以展示汇总数据或创建更复杂的表格布局。数据验证功能确保用户输入的数据符合预设的规则,减少了错误数据的输入。

  • 行列管理

Luckysheet 的行列管理功能为用户提供了灵活的表格结构调整能力。用户可以根据需要隐藏或显示行列,有助于集中注意力在关键数据上,同时保持表格的整洁。插入和删除行列的功能使得用户可以根据数据的变化灵活地调整表格结构。行列冻结功能允许用户固定表格的某些行或列,即使在滚动表格时也能保持这些行或列的可见性。行列拆分则使得用户可以查看或编辑表格的不同部分,而不需要滚动屏幕。

  • 操作功能

Luckysheet 的操作功能集合了多种常用命令,提高了用户的工作效率。撤销和重做功能允许用户轻松回退或重做他们的操作,减少了误操作的风险。复制、粘贴和剪切是基本的编辑功能,允许用户快速复制或移动数据。快捷键支持让用户可以使用键盘快速执行常见操作,提高了操作的速度。格式刷功能允许用户将一个单元格的格式应用到其他单元格,保持了表格的一致性。拖选功能使用户可以通过拖动鼠标来选择一个区域的单元格,方便进行批量操作。

  • 公式与函数

Luckysheet 提供了丰富的公式和函数库,满足从基本到高级的数据处理需求。内置公式包括常见的数学、统计、逻辑和文本函数,用户可以直接在单元格中使用这些函数进行计算。远程公式允许用户引用其他工作表或文档中的数据,实现了数据的跨表格计算。自定义公式功能则为用户提供了灵活性,可以创建符合特定需求的公式。这些公式和函数的组合使得 Luckysheet 成为一个强大的数据处理工具。

  • 数据管理

Luckysheet 的数据管理功能使用户能够高效地组织和分析表格中的数据。数据过滤功能允许用户根据特定的条件筛选数据,快速找到所需的记录。排序功能则可以按照一个或多个列对数据进行升序或降序排列,使得用户可以轻松地对数据进行分类和比较。

  • 增强功能

Luckysheet 的增强功能集合了多种高级工具,以满足用户在数据处理和展示上的复杂需求。数据透视表功能使用户能够对数据进行汇总和分析,快速得到有意义的洞察。图表插件支持将表格数据转化为图形表示,使得数据趋势和模式更加直观。评论功能允许用户在单元格中添加注释,便于团队成员之间的交流和协作。协作编辑功能使得多个用户可以同时在线编辑同一个表格,提高了团队工作的效率。图片插入功能丰富了表格的内容,使得用户可以在单元格中嵌入图像。矩阵计算功能支持对数据集进行更高级的数学运算。截图功能允许用户将表格的当前状态保存为图片,方便进行演示或分享。复制到其他格式功能使得用户可以将表格数据导出为不同的文件格式,如 PDF 或图片。Excel 导入导出功能则确保了与现有电子表格软件的兼容性,方便用户在 Luckysheet 和其他工具之间迁移数据。


信息

截至发稿概况如下:

  • 软件地址:https://github.com/dream-num/Luckysheet

  • 软件协议:MIT license

  • 编程语言

语言占比
JavaScript90.9%
HTML6.4%
CSS2.7%
  • 收藏数量:15.7K

尽管 Luckysheet 提供了众多令人印象深刻的功能,但它作为一个开源项目,可能面临社区活跃度和长期维护的挑战。随着技术的不断进步和用户需求的不断变化,项目需要持续更新以适应新的浏览器技术、安全标准和功能需求。为了确保 Luckysheet 能够长期发展,社区需要更多的贡献者参与到代码开发、文档编写、问题解答和新功能设计中来。同时,项目维护者应该关注用户反馈,及时修复已知问题,并根据用户的实际使用场景不断优化产品,以维持其竞争力和吸引力。

各位在使用 Luckysheet 的过程中是否发现了什么问题?或者对 Luckysheet 的功能有什么提议?热烈欢迎各位在评论区分享交流心得与见解!!!


声明:本文为辣码甄源原创,转载请标注"辣码甄源原创首发"并附带原文链接。

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.mzph.cn/bicheng/43219.shtml

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

windows环境下部署多个端口Tomcat服务和开机自启动设置保姆级教程

前言 本文主要介绍了 windows环境下,配置多个Tomcat设置不同端口启动服务。其实在思路上Linux上也是适用的,只是 Linux 上没有可视化客户端,会麻烦些,但总体的思路上是一样的。 注:文章中涉及些文字和图片是搬运了其他…

OpenGL3.3_C++_Windows(28)

Demo演示 demo 视差贴图 视差/高度/位移贴图(黑--白):和法线贴图一样视差贴图能够极大提升表面细节,使之具有深度感。第一种思路(置换顶点):对于一个quad ,分成约1000个顶点&#x…

C语言 | Leetcode C语言题解之第223题矩形面积

题目: 题解: int computeArea(int ax1, int ay1, int ax2, int ay2, int bx1, int by1, int bx2, int by2) {int area1 (ax2 - ax1) * (ay2 - ay1), area2 (bx2 - bx1) * (by2 - by1);int overlapWidth fmin(ax2, bx2) - fmax(ax1, bx1), overlapHei…

Visual Studio Code 教程 VsCode安装Live Server以服务形式打开html

搜索Live Server 插件,然后安装 选一个html文件,右键点击 Open with live server,然后就自动弹出来了

使用paddleOCR训练自己的数据集到ONNX推理

一、环境安装 1、安装paddlepaddle; https://www.paddlepaddle.org.cn/ 这里安装2.6.1的话使用onnx会出现swish算子报错的问题 python -m pip install paddlepaddle-gpu2.5.2 -i https://pypi.tuna.tsinghua.edu.cn/simple验证是否成功安装 python import paddl…

Mysql Workbench的使用

本篇内容:对Mysql Workbench的常规使用学习 一、知识储备 1. Workbench 可以做什么 是mysql数据库可视化管理的一款免费工具,除了平常的通过sql语句,进行创建数据库表、增删改查外,还可以利用其进行建模创建数据库表。通过创建…

人工智能的新时代:从模型到应用的转变

💝💝💝欢迎来到我的博客,很高兴能够在这里和您见面!希望您在这里可以感受到一份轻松愉快的氛围,不仅可以获得有趣的内容和知识,也可以畅所欲言、分享您的想法和见解。 推荐:kwan 的首页,持续学…

【Linux】记录一起网站劫持事件

故事很短,处理也简单。权当记录一下,各位安全大大们手下留情。 最近一位客户遇到官网被劫持的情况,想我们帮忙解决一下(本来不关我们的事,毕竟情面在这…还是无偿地协助一下),经过三四轮“谦让…

Conda修改默认环境创建路径

conda安装好后默认将新建环境安装在C盘 修改.condarc 配置文件 注 : Windows操作系统创建的 .condarc 文件通常在 C:\Users\User_name 这个目录下; 注 : Linux操作系统创建的 .condarc 文件通常在/home/User_name 这个目录下。 在.condarc文件中添加以下内容 有…

SpringBoot整合MongoDB文档相关操作

文章目录 SpringBoot整合MongoDB文档操作添加文档查询文档更新文档删除文档 SpringBoot整合MongoDB 创建项目&#xff0c;添加依赖&#xff0c;配置连接 <dependency><groupId>org.springframework.boot</groupId><artifactId>spring-boot-starter-dat…

Python 数据容器的对比

五类数据容器 列表&#xff0c;元组&#xff0c;字符串&#xff0c;集合&#xff0c;字典 是否能下标索引 支持&#xff1a;列表&#xff0c;元组&#xff0c;字符串 不支持&#xff1a;集合&#xff0c;字典 是否能放重复元素 是&#xff1a;列表&#xff0c;元组&#…

遥感分类产品精度验证之TIF验证TIF

KKB_2020.tif KKB_2020_JRC.tif kkb.geojson 所用到的包&#xff1a;&#xff08;我嫌geopandas安装太麻烦colab做的。。 import rasterio import geopandas as gpd import numpy as np import pandas as pd import matplotlib.pyplot as plt from sklearn.metrics import c…

【零基础】学JS之APIS(基于黑马)

喝下这碗鸡汤 披盔戴甲,一路勇往直前! 1. 什么是事件 事件是在编程时系统内发生的动作或者发生的事情 比如用户在网页上单击一个按钮 2. 什么是事件监听? 就是让程序检测是否有事件产生&#xff0c;一旦有事件触发&#xff0c;就立即调用一个函数做出响应&#xff0c;也称为 注…

如何用java语言开发一套数字化产科系统 数字化产科管理平台源码

如何用java语言开发一套数字化产科系统 数字化产科管理平台源码 要使用Java语言来开发一个数字化产科系统&#xff0c;你需要遵循一系列步骤&#xff0c;从环境搭建到系统设计与开发&#xff0c;再到测试与部署。 以下是一个大致的开发流程概览&#xff1a; 1. 环境搭建 Jav…

从Docker 网络看IaC

【引子】近来&#xff0c;老码农又一次有机会实施IaC 了&#xff0c; 但是环境有了新的变化&#xff0c;涵盖了云环境、虚拟机、K8S 以及Docker&#xff0c;而网络自动化则是IaC中的重要组成&#xff0c;温故知新&#xff0c;面向Docker 的网络是怎样的呢&#xff1f; Docker …

C++相关概念和易错语法(16)(list)

1.list易错点 &#xff08;1&#xff09;慎用list的sort&#xff0c;list的排序比vector慢得多&#xff0c;尽管两者时间复杂度一样&#xff0c;甚至不如先把list转为vector&#xff0c;用vector排完序后再转为list &#xff08;2&#xff09;splice是剪切链表&#xff0c;将…

指数增长远大于nlgn

在学习算法导论的时候&#xff0c;遇到了这么一行字把我难住了。我不理解为什么叶节点代价总和就为Ω(nlgn)了&#xff0c;后来经过学习之后了解了&#xff0c;因为n的指数严格大于1&#xff0c;只要指数函数的指数大于1就是指数增长&#xff0c;那么就远大于nlgn。

C++ | Leetcode C++题解之第22题完全二叉树的节点个数

题目&#xff1a; 题解&#xff1a; class Solution { public:int countNodes(TreeNode* root) {if (root nullptr) {return 0;}int level 0;TreeNode* node root;while (node->left ! nullptr) {level;node node->left;}int low 1 << level, high (1 <&…

【笔记】finalshell中使用nano编辑器GNU

ctrl O 保存 enter 确定 ctrl X 退出 nano编辑 能不用就不用吧 因为我真用不习惯 nano编辑的文件也可以用vim编辑的

Social to Sales全链路,数说故事专享会开启出海新视角

————瞎出海&#xff0c;必出局 TikTok&#xff0c;这个充满活力的短视频平台&#xff0c;已经成为全球范围内不可忽视的电商巨头。就在6月8日&#xff0c;TikTok美区带货直播诞生了首个“百万大场”。在此之前&#xff0c;百万GMV被视为一道难以逾越的高墙。以TikTok为首的…